  • Signings will be the focus at The Valley, but it seems prospect Reuben Gokah is heading out the exit door.

    Writing on his Patreon, reporter Alan Nixon has said that Premier League side Everton have swooped for the Charlton Athletic talent.

    Aged only 16, the Toffees view centre-back Gokah as a big talent for the future and have moved to secure his services early. A deal has been sorted and he seems poised to make the move to Bramley Moore Dock.

    It is not said what sort of fee CAFC will be getting from the sale if they are to land one, but it will be expected that a sum is involved as they bid farewell to one of their brighter youth prodigies.
